하루 한 시간씩 유튜브에서 라이브하는 velopert 당신은 무엇? 일주일 여행 다녀오고, 회사 일에 치여서 잠시 번아웃이었다. graphql 구조 덕분에 골머리를 썩고 있다. 회원가입은 제쳐두고 본격적으로 시작할까하다가도 성격이 뭐같아서 그냥 지나치지 못하겠다. 아! 제목이 day... 인 이유는 계속 숫자를 붙여나가는 것이 참 어렵고 어려운 일이라는...
으아.. 이메일로 가입시키는 기능도 쉽지가 않다. typeorm / jwt / shortid / mail-gun / cookie / auth 방법 (refresh,access) 이걸 뭐라고 부르는지 잘 모르겠지만.. 이렇게 준비해서 만들 수 있을 것 같은데, 최대한 단순화하고 싶은데, 쉽지가 않다. rest를 써볼까 graphql로 할까 생각해봤는데,...
하루 늦은 일지 주말이라는 핑계로 벌써 쳐졌나 싶었다. typeOrm과 graphql을 사용하는 구성에 대해서 계속 생각해보고 있다. 리졸브와 쿼리를 비즈니스 기능별로 쪼개는게 맞는지? 객체별로 리졸브와 쿼리를 구성하는게 맞는지? 번외로 DataLoader는 왜 써야하는지 검색해보았다. 배치와 캐싱에 장점이 있다는 것으로 보이는데, 배치는 N+1 문제...
휴일이기도 하고 머리를 하느라 시간을 너무 많이 보냈다. 아침 일찍 일이나서 다시 자면 도저히 일찍 일어날 수가 없다. 타입스크립트 제네릭이 가끔씩 눈에 거슬리는데 오늘 확실히 개념을 잡고 자야겠다. 마크다운도 자연스럽게 익숙해지도록 하나하나 써봐야겠다. .....generic 코드로 실험 중.. 일단 취침!
이직 준비와 개발 공부와 괴리가 조금 있다고 생각하는데, 남들도 그렇게 생각하는지 모르겠다. 누군가는 부러워하는 회사를 다니고 있으면서도, 나보다 어떤 측면에서든 조금 더 나은 회사를 다니는 누군가를 부러워하고 이직을 여러번하고 있는 누군가를 보며 "내가 뭔가 잘못하고 있는가?" 라는 생각을 한다. 아무튼 앞으로 딱 1년 두개의 프로젝트를 시도해보고,...